About This Home

Step into a living piece of Virginia's past. This site is steeped in history, with its origins tracing back to 1723 when Beverley Stanard built the original grist mill. This faithful mill, possibly known as Stanard Mill before it became Roxbury Mill, served the community until 1941, grinding for nearly two centuries. The property was also part of the historic "Roxbury Plantation," a vast 2,000-acre tract settled by the prominent Stanard family.

A comprehensive archaeological reconnaissance was conducted on the Roxbury Tract in 1993 by The Center for Historic Preservation at Mary Washington College. This study included extensive historical and Civil War research, confirming the property's deep roots and potential for significant findings, with an artifact catalogue included in the report.

A Glimpse into Civil War History: This property isn't just old; it's witnessed pivotal moments in American history. Documents from the National Park Service confirm that Union and Confederate soldiers engaged in combat on at least three occasions at the Telegraph Road crossing on the Po River, with fighting likely occurring on the portion of the estate east of the road and north of the river, within what was known as the Stanard estate.

Preserving its heritage, the property features the original dam that once powered the mill, and the original millrace still actively flows. And, with the picturesque Po River flowing through the property, there's documented potential for hydroelectric power. A 1981 study prepared by the U.S. Department of Energy and the Virginia Office of Emergency and Energy Services specifically inventoried existing dams, including this one, for their hydroelectric potential ranging between 100kw and 30,000kw, offering a unique opportunity to harness the river's energy for sustainable living or even income generation.
